Output 40de1603505a85d1eafd87f9b357251adcf6e683e7a85fb54c7a0427642a2d46:1

value
133067551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 726f6e506ff6501b201ae24a606a55458eaf1b45 OP_EQUAL
address
3C86SmWD4iU2HPZno66qb1E1Ak2M23id8h
transaction
40de1603505a85d1eafd87f9b357251adcf6e683e7a85fb54c7a0427642a2d46
confirmations
241459
spent
true